What is a ET-85 used for?

Form ET-85 is used to certify that estate taxes have been addressed for a deceased individual's estate in New York State. This form is necessary for the transfer of property ownership and ensures compliance with state tax regulations.

Who needs to fill out a ET-85 form

The executor, administrator, or personal representative of the estate is responsible for completing this form if the estate is subject to New York State estate tax.
